AI Inference Engineer
Fuse Energy is a forward-thinking renewable energy startup on a mission to deliver a terawatt of renewable energy - fast. They are seeking a Founding AI Inference Engineer to define and build how Fuse serves AI inference workloads at scale, focusing on architecture and performance optimization.

Responsibilities
Define Fuse's inference serving strategy and architecture from first principles
Design and build the serving stack: request routing, batching, scheduling, and autoscaling for high-throughput, latency-sensitive inference workloads
Own model-level optimisation strategy for serving - deciding where and how to apply quantisation, distillation, speculative decoding, and similar techniques to improve throughput and cost per token, partnering with the CUDA/GPU engineers
Make the core software architecture calls on serving frameworks and orchestration (e.g. vLLM, TensorRT-LLM, SGLang, Triton Inference Server, or equivalents)
Translate throughput, latency, and uptime commitments into concrete technical specifications and serving capacity plans
Act as a direct technical owner of inference performance and reliability
Work closely with the CUDA and GPU engineering teams to ensure custom kernels and hardware performance work are integrated cleanly into the serving layer
Set the standards, tooling, and benchmarks this function will run on as it grows
Qualification
Required
4+ years of experience building or operating large-scale inference serving systems, or equivalent strong project/industry experience
Deep, hands-on experience with inference serving frameworks and the techniques used to optimise them (batching, KV-cache management, quantisation, speculative decoding)
Strong systems thinking - able to reason about the full path from incoming request to served response across a large cluster
Comfortable working directly with GPU/CUDA engineers to integrate low-level performance work into a serving system
A track record of making high-stakes architecture calls and owning the outcome
Comfort operating without a playbook - this is a founding role shaping a new function around architecture that's still early-stage, not joining an established one
Preferred
Experience with Triton or custom ML inference/training frameworks
Experience with autoscaling or capacity planning for large-scale inference workloads
Exposure to multi-tenant serving or SLA-driven infrastructure
Background at a hyperscaler, frontier AI lab, or large-scale distributed inference system
Familiarity with Kubernetes/Slurm for cluster orchestration
Interest or experience in energy markets, grid systems, or sustainability-focused compute
